Ethan McIlroy captains the squad that features 10 senior players and 10 Academy talents.
The fixture will be streamed live via Access Munster
Supporters will have to sign up as a member at €4 to watch the fixture. Entry to the match at New Ormond Park is €10.
In the front row, senior men's prop, Callum Reid, starts at loosehead, with senior hooker, James McCormick, and Academy tighthead prop, Flynn Longstaff.
In the second row, Development lock, Joe Hopes, starts alongside first year Academy forward Paddy Woods .
In the back row, Academy forwards James McKillop and Tom Brigg start at blindside and openside flanker respectively, with senior forward Lorcan McLoughlin, starting at number eight.
Two senior players start in the half back positions with Conor McKee starting at scrum-half and Jake Flannery starting at fly-half.
In the midfield, senior centre Ben Carson starts at inside centre and Academy back Wilhelm De Klerk starts at outside centre.
In the back three, Ben Moxham starts on the left wing, Academy back Jonathan Scott starts on the right wing. Ethan McIlroy completes the starting XV at full-back and captains the side.
The bench features four Academy players, one senior player and four pathway talents.
Jacob Boyd, Henry Walker, Tom McAllister, Ben Moore, Noah Bell and Jon Rodgers are the forward replacements.
Clark Logan, James Humphreys and Owen O'Kane are the backline cover options.
Owen O'Kane, Ben Moore and Jon Rodgers are National Talent Squad players and Noah Bell is a Provincial Talent Squad player.
